Garage floor installation services involve preparing and installing a durable surface over existing concrete or other subfloor materials in a garage. The process typically includes cleaning the existing surface, addressing any cracks or imperfections, and applying a suitable coating or overlay that can withstand vehicle traffic, chemical spills, and daily wear. Depending on the chosen material, installation can involve pouring new concrete, applying epoxy coatings, or laying interlocking tiles, all designed to create a smooth, resilient, and visually appealing garage floor.
These services help address common problems such as cracks, stains, and uneven surfaces that can compromise the functionality and appearance of a garage. Cracks and surface damage may pose safety hazards or lead to further deterioration if not properly repaired. Installing a new garage floor can also improve resistance to oil spills, water damage, and staining, making maintenance easier and extending the lifespan of the underlying concrete. Material Costs - The cost of materials for garage floor installation typically ranges from $3 to $12 per square foot. For example, epoxy coatings may cost around $4 to $7 per square foot, while concrete overlays can be $6 to $12 per square foot. Prices vary based on material choice and quality.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a garage floor generally fall between $2 and $6 per square foot. The total labor fee depends on the project's complexity and the local contractor rates. Additional prep work may increase overall costs.
Preparation and Surface Work - Surface preparation, including cleaning and repairing existing floors, can add approximately $1 to $3 per square foot. Proper prep ensures durability and may influence the final cost depending on the condition of the existing floor.
Total Installation Costs - Overall costs for garage floor installation typically range from $4 to $20 per square foot. The final price depends on material selection, surface condition, and project size, with larger areas generally offering better cost efficiency.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of garage floor finishes are available? Local service providers offer various options including epoxy coatings, concrete staining, and overlays to enhance durability and appearance.
How long does a garage floor installation typically take? The duration depends on the chosen finish and project size, but most installations can be completed within a few days.
Are garage floor coatings resistant to stains and wear? Many coatings provided by local pros are designed to be resistant to stains, chemicals, and general wear for long-lasting protection.
What preparation is needed before installing a garage floor coating? Proper surface cleaning, repairs, and sometimes etching are required to ensure good adhesion and a smooth finish.
Can existing garage floors be resurfaced or upgraded? Yes, many local contractors offer resurfacing options to improve the look and performance of existing garage floors.
